A technical machinist is asked to build a cubical steel tank that will hold 195 L of water. Calculate in meters the smallest pos
Aleks04 [339]

Answer:

The smallest possible inside length of the tank is 0.579 m.

Explanation:

As we know that

1 m^3 = 1000 L

Thus, volume of 195 liter tank is also equal to 0.195 cubic meter

The volume of a cube is equal to x^3, where, x is the length of the side of the cube

With the give condition,

x^ 3 = 0.195

Solving the above equation, we get -

x = (0.195)^{\frac{1}{3})}\\x = 0.579

The smallest possible inside length of the tank is 0.579 m.

What did the Aboriginal people use to weave dilly bags?
timofeeve [1]

Answer:

This bag has been made from introduced materials, but before foreign fibres were used dilly bags were made from bark, leaves, stems, roots, human hair, animal fur and animal sinew.
